Analysis of Easy ML for Java

Overall verdict

  • Easy ML for Java appears to be a lightweight, approachable library aimed at bringing machine learning capabilities to Java developers without requiring deep ML expertise or switching to Python-centric ecosystems. It seems suitable for developers who want to integrate basic ML functionality into existing Java applications with minimal overhead, though it likely lacks the depth, community support, and cutting-edge features of major frameworks like TensorFlow, PyTorch, or scikit-learn.

Why this product is good

  • Native Java implementation avoids the need for language interop or JNI bridges to Python-based ML libraries
  • Simpler API design makes it more accessible for Java developers without extensive ML background
  • Documentation via GitBook suggests an organized, readable learning path for newcomers
  • Lightweight footprint can be beneficial for integrating into existing Java-based systems without heavy dependencies
  • Good fit for educational purposes or prototyping simple ML concepts within a Java codebase

Recommended for

  • Java developers who want to experiment with ML without learning Python
  • Small to medium projects requiring basic classification, regression, or clustering functionality
  • Students or educators teaching foundational ML concepts using Java
  • Teams with existing Java infrastructure who need lightweight ML integration without major architectural changes
  • Prototyping and proof-of-concept work rather than production-grade, large-scale ML systems
